Transaction 424eaa3ed377274bfa7f8e6e260828feee7c323dada3630c65168121cb679e15
1 Input
2 Outputs
- 424eaa3ed377274bfa7f8e6e260828feee7c323dada3630c65168121cb679e15:0
- 424eaa3ed377274bfa7f8e6e260828feee7c323dada3630c65168121cb679e15:1
value 20000
address 37P8thrtDXb6Di5E7f4FL3bpzum3fhUvT7
value 1108192
address 12XGBCJkSF1pvKzJvtmD4QqdQViV7QxNAt